The Significance of Yopo Seeds in Culture
Yopo seeds have a rich history in the indigenous cultures of South America, particularly among the Yanomami and Ticuna tribes. These seeds are often ground into a powder and snorted or ingested, producing visionary experiences. Their active compounds, primarily bufotenin and 5-MeO-DMT, contribute to their psychoactive effects, making them an essential part of ritualistic practices aimed at healing and spiritual guidance.
Many people turn to Yopo seeds for both recreational and spiritual experiences. They are often used in shamanic ceremonies, where experienced practitioners guide participants through their journeys. This traditional context enhances the overall experience, fostering a deep connection to nature and the universe.
